i see a lot people on here say freeing up ram aka closing apps aka freeing up memory with sbsettings helps when their phone is running a bit slow/laggy
 
If the app in question was designed to run indefinitely in the background such as TomTom then yes, closing those types of apps down will improve performance. But I've had 30+ apps open without the RAM usage going up and if I leave it long enough, the RAM usage will go down. But you are correct in that if you want to free memory right away you'll notice better performance.
 
I prefer to let my iPhone choose when to close them down or not.
